Are vintage Apple products still eligible for repairs?

socratic-gpt
Socrates

Yes, vintage Apple products are still eligible for repairs, but repairs are based on parts availability. A product loses all hardware service when it becomes "obsolete," which happens when Apple stopped distributing it for sale more than seven years ago.

How long ago was the iPhone X discontinued by Apple?

socratic-gpt
Socrates

The iPhone X was discontinued by Apple on September 12, 2018, following the announcement of the iPhone XS, iPhone XS Max, and iPhone XR devices.

What criteria makes an Apple product "vintage"?

socratic-gpt
Socrates

An Apple product is considered "vintage" when Apple stopped distributing it for sale more than five years ago, but less than seven years ago. Vintage products may still be eligible for repairs, but it depends on parts availability.
